Stola Sto"la, n.; pl. Stol[ae]. [L. See Stole a garment.] (Rom. Antiq.) A long garment, descending to the ankles, worn by Roman women. The stola was not allowed to be worn by courtesans, or by women who had been divorced from their husbands. --Fairholt.
